What anterior pituitary hormone stimulates mammary gland colostrum production in late pregnancy?luteinizing hormoneoxytocinhuman
yarga [219]

Answer: Prolactin

Explanation:

By the 5-6 month of pregnancy the breasts becomes ready to produce milk or colostrum. During the late stages of pregnancy, the women breast enter into the lactogenesis first stage. The level of prolactin rises. After birth the prolactin levels remains high the breast is stimulated. The release of prolactin triggers the cells present in the alveoli of the breast to secrete milk.
